“The first time I heard the song, I was like, ‘Eh, I don’t know, dude. I ain’t feeling that,’” she explained. “When it first happened, I was sharing myself [with Jay], not to share myself with the world.” But after a few conversations with her son, she finally gave him the OK to use the song. “I was never ashamed of me,” she said. “But in my family, it was something that was never discussed. I’m tired of all the mystery. I’m gonna give it to ’em . . . Now it’s time for me to live my life and be happy, be free.” That powerful sentiment echoes the tone of Carter’s beautiful spoken outro on “Smile”: “Living in the shadow feels like the safe place to be / No harm for them, no harm for me / But life is short, and it’s time to be free / Love who you love, because life isn’t guaranteed.” Read More… http://ift.tt/2xVcPBI
